Custom

The Custom tab allows you to create customized reports based on the historical performance, events, and
inventory information gathered by Fabric Manager Server. You can create aggregate reports with
summary and detailed views. You can also view previously saved reports.
The Custom tab contains the following subtabs:

Create—Creates a report template, allowing you to select any combination of events, performance
categories, and inventory.
View—View previously saved reports.
Generate—Generates a custom report based on the selected report template.
Edit—Edits an existing report template.
Scheduled Jobs—View scheduled jobs based on the selected report template.
